Freeze Watch issued April 24 at 9:37AM EDT until April 25 at 9:00AM EDT by NWS Wilmington OH (details ...)
* WHAT...Sub-freezing temperatures as low as 31 possible.
* WHERE...Portions of central and west central Ohio.
* WHEN...From late tonight through Thursday morning.
* IMPACTS...Frost and freeze conditions could kill crops, other sensitive vegetation and possibly damage unprotected outdoor plumbing.

MARIA STEIN - Last year it took a late aerial attack, but this year it was pretty much ground and pound.
The Marion Local Flyers topped the Shawnee Indians in Friday night's gridiron lid-lifter, as the hosts used a punishing rushing attack to cruise to a 34-13 victory.
